# Mysql数据库迁移方案
## 概述
在实际开发中,我们经常需要将Mysql数据库从一个环境迁移到另一个环境,比如从开发环境迁移到测试环境或者生产环境。这样的迁移需要保证数据的一致性和完整性,同时也需要尽量减少迁移过程中的停机时间。本文将介绍一种常见的Mysql数据库迁移方案,并详细说明每个步骤需要做什么。
## 迁移步骤
下面是Mysql数据库迁移的一般步骤,我们将使用表格展示这些步骤
原创
2023-07-21 22:54:04
258阅读
背景介绍近期项目要从Oracle数据库向MySQL数据库迁移,本文档整理了项目中常规用到的SQL,及在Oracle与MySQL环境下的SQL语言差异,并对如何解决差异性问题,进行了探索。本文档所比较的数据库版本,Oracle为 11g,MySQL为5.5。差异比对MySQL与Oracle的差异性,详列如下。SQL基本语法差异MySQL的SQL语句中,要求表名、表的别名必须区分大小写(可通过修改my
转载
2024-06-11 00:29:31
101阅读
Mysql百万级数据迁移实战笔记方案选择mysqldump迁移平常开发中,我们比较经常使用的数据备份迁移方式是用mysqldump工具导出一个sql文件,再在新数据库中导入sql来完成数据迁移。试验发现,通过mysqldump导出百万级量的数据库成一个sql文件,大概耗时几分钟,导出的sql文件大小在1G左右,然后再把这个1G的sql文件通过scp命令复制到另一台服务器,大概也需要耗时几分钟。在新
转载
2023-05-19 16:22:48
242阅读
专业的SQL Server、MySQL数据库同步软件\ ORACLE和MYSQL作为两种使用最广泛的关系数据库软件,在各种功能和编程语法上仍然存在很大差异,因此要实现将系统从ORACLE迁移到MYSQL数据库,数据的迁移只是一个方面。最大的挑战在于代码级别的更改。整个迁移的一般工作如下:\1 ORACLE和MYSQL函数之间的区别:\(1)字段类型的比较:序列号ORACLEMYSQL1VARCHA
转载
2024-06-01 17:01:05
68阅读
前言系统运行有很多年了。 数据库服务器也运行很多年了,性能比较老旧,SSD硬盘容量只有250G,在各种需求下,当前服务器的磁盘即将不足。所以开启了本次数据库的迁移行动。需求迁移的数据量高达130多G, 保证数百万用户的数据安全。不能影响线上正常运行或将影响降到最低保证迁移前后的数据安全与精确还原。思路1 .先备份数据 2. 以现有数据库为主数据库搭建从数据库(从主复制)。 3. 检查从数据库数据是
转载
2023-08-17 20:39:56
207阅读
1需求背景应用侧的同学需要对数据进行导出和导入,于是跑来找 DBA 咨询问题:MySQL 如何导入大批量的数据?应用侧目前的方式:mysqldump 工具select outfile 语句图形化管理工具(MySQL Workbench、Navicat 、DBeaver)DBA 听了觉得挺好的呀!DBA 想了,我的数据库我做主。通知应用侧,目前先使用之前熟悉的方式进行,测试之后给建议。Tips:为了
转载
2024-05-31 08:24:43
146阅读
一、备份方案1.1 备份方案具体步骤旧的zabbix:oldIP,新的zabbix:newIP方案1【不推荐】:数据量65G全备oldIP的mysql,耗时大约:十个小时恢复到newIP的mysql:耗时:十几个小时损失监控数据:二十几个小时 方案2无缝迁移【推荐】:1、【新的zabbix服务器准备工作】:安装新的zabbix服务端,客户端,mysql安装5.1版本
原创
2015-09-24 17:06:03
3256阅读
点赞
2评论
文章目录停机迁移方案双写迁移方案其他一、现状二、目标三、解决方案四、采坑五、结果 停机迁移方案我先给你说一个最 low 的方案,就是很简单,大家伙儿凌晨 12 点开始运维,网站或者 app 挂个公告,说 0 点到早上 6 点进行运维,无法访问。接着到 0 点停机,系统停掉,没有流量写入了,此时老的单库单表数据库静止了。然后你之前得写好一个导数的一次性工具,此时直接跑起来,然后将单库单表的数据哗哗
转载
2024-07-10 23:06:07
55阅读
停机迁移 不停机迁移
原创
2022-12-22 00:25:53
559阅读
ORACLE数据库迁移至MYSQL方案(2015年) ORACLE和MYSQL作为两款使用最广泛的关系型数据库软件,在各项功能上以及编程语法上还是存在很大的差异的,因此要实现将系统从ORACLE迁移至MYSQL数据库上,数据的迁移仅仅是一方面,最大的挑战在于代码层面的改动,整个迁移的大致工作如下: 1、ORACLE与MYSQL功能上的区别: (1)字段类型的对比:序号
转载
2024-08-27 17:23:09
99阅读
去年年底做了不少系统的数据迁移,大部分系统由于平台和版本的原因,做的是逻辑迁移,少部分做的是物理迁移,有一些心得体会,与大家分享。首先说说迁移流程,在迁移之前,写好方案,特别是实施的方案步骤一定要写清楚,然后进行完整的测试。我们在迁移时,有的系统测试了四五次,通过测试来完善方案和流程。针对物理迁移,也即通过RMAN备份来进行还原并应用归档的方式(这里不讨论通过dd方式进行的冷迁移),虽然注意的是要
转载
2024-07-10 22:38:18
20阅读
场景:由于更换设备,需要将现mysql数据库迁移到新服务器的mysql数据库中。迁移命令:1、在源库mysql执行命令如下,将导出数据到/root/目录下(1)导出所有数据库的表结构和数据mysqldump -uroot -p123456 --all-databases > /root/alldata.sql(2)导出指定数据库(user)的所有表结构和数据mysqldump -uroot
转载
2023-05-18 12:57:54
1127阅读
点赞
SyncNavigator是一款功能强大的数据库同步软件,适用于SQLSERVER, MySQL,具有自动/定时同步数据、无人值守、故障自动恢复、同构/异构数据库同步、断点续传和增量同步等功能,支持Windows xp以上所有操作系统,适用于大容量数据库快速同步。安装包下载地址:https://www.syncnavigator.cn/Setup.zip帮助文档地址:https://www.syncnavigator.cn/Help_zh-CN.chmWeb文档地址:https://www...
原创
2021-06-07 14:04:08
968阅读
公司现有运行系统有一套RAC集群。由两台服务器和一台HP MSA1000存储组成,搭载RedhatEnterprise AS4及Oracle 10g。我现在所要做的工作就是将RAC集群撤销,再搭建单节点Oracle数据库服务器。
原创
2013-02-05 09:03:53
1386阅读
项目背景:数据库数据量:2T,BI数据仓库操作系统升级:suse linux11sp1升级到sp2数据库升级:数据库从10G升级到11G,服务器硬件升级:服务器换新机器,旧机器(24cpu(逻辑)、32G内存),新机器(80cpu、512G内存)。存储升级:存储更换为新一代。 跟qq群里的兄弟们进行了热烈的讨论,大家都在考虑,到底哪种迁移工具更好一些?最后大家一致认为,评价优异顺序为:传输表空间&
转载
2013-07-20 19:27:00
105阅读
2评论
物理迁移数据库
原创
2022-12-02 11:22:48
304阅读
# Shardingsphere 数据库迁移方案实现教程
## 1. 概述
在本文中,我将向你介绍如何使用Shardingsphere来实现数据库迁移方案。Shardingsphere是一个开源的分布式数据库中间件,它能够帮助我们实现数据库的分片和分库功能,并且提供了方便的数据迁移工具。
## 2. 整体流程
首先,让我们来看一下整个数据库迁移方案的流程。
```mermaid
flowc
原创
2024-01-10 04:01:04
248阅读
MySQL数据库迁移到Oracle时间: 2016-08-04 15:10:21前言本人迁移的数据库规模不大.大型数据库未做尝试请务必注意文中提到的一些注意事项本文中,要迁移的mysql数据库名称为jxcms,oracle sql developer中配置的连接oralce数据库的用户为rwdb.所有内容均基于这个前提采用工具Oracle SQL Developer 版本4.1.3.20mysql
转载
2024-01-11 16:45:54
374阅读
一. 数据还原1. 使用 mysql 命令还原 对于已经备份的包含 CREATE、INSERT 语句的文本文件,可以使用 mysql 命令导入到数据库中。 语法格式如下: mysql
转载
2023-08-16 16:51:40
132阅读
背景Oracle数据库提供了sequence的特性,即用户可以通过create sequence seq语法创建一个sequence对象,用来生成一个单机或者RAC环境下,唯一,单调递增/递减,全局有序(RAC环境)的数字,极大的简化了应用的设计,满足应用对全局唯一的需求。然而, MySQL 并没有sequence对象类型的存在,为满足用户使用需求, RDS for MySQL移植了Oracle的
转载
2024-07-21 23:48:59
88阅读